    After undergoing a hair transplant in Halifax, it's crucial to follow the post-operative care instructions provided by your surgeon to ensure optimal healing and successful results. One common question among patients is when they can safely wash their hair after the procedure.

    Typically, patients are advised to wait at least 48 hours post-surgery before washing their hair. This waiting period allows the initial healing process to begin, reducing the risk of infection and ensuring that the newly transplanted hair follicles are secure. During this time, it's important to avoid any direct water contact with the treated area.

    After the 48-hour mark, you can gently wash your hair using lukewarm water and a mild, sulfate-free shampoo. It's essential to be very gentle to avoid dislodging the grafts. Use your fingertips to lightly massage the scalp, avoiding any scrubbing or vigorous rubbing. Rinse thoroughly and pat the area dry with a clean towel, being careful not to rub.

    For the first week, continue to wash your hair daily, maintaining the same gentle approach. After a week, you can gradually increase the frequency and intensity of your hair washing routine, but always prioritize gentleness to protect the newly transplanted hair.

    Following these guidelines will help promote proper healing and ensure the best possible outcome from your hair transplant procedure in Halifax. Always consult with your surgeon for personalized advice tailored to your specific situation.

    When Can I Wash My Hair After Hair Transplant In Halifax?

    After undergoing a hair transplant in Halifax, it's crucial to follow the post-operative care instructions provided by your doctor to ensure optimal healing and successful results. One of the most common questions patients ask is, "When can I wash my hair after the procedure?" Here’s a detailed guide to help you understand the importance of timing and the proper techniques for washing your hair post-transplant.

    The Importance of Waiting 48 Hours

    Immediately after your hair transplant, your scalp will be in a delicate state. The transplanted hair follicles need time to settle and begin the healing process. Waiting 48 hours before washing your hair allows the initial healing to commence, reducing the risk of infection and ensuring that the newly transplanted follicles remain securely in place.

    Gentle Washing Techniques

    Once the 48-hour period has passed, you can begin washing your hair. It's essential to use a gentle approach to avoid dislodging the newly transplanted follicles. Here are some tips for a safe and effective hair washing routine:

    1. Use Mild Shampoo: Choose a mild, sulfate-free shampoo that is gentle on the scalp. Avoid any products that contain harsh chemicals or fragrances.

    2. Warm Water Only: Use lukewarm water to rinse your hair. Hot water can irritate the scalp and potentially damage the new follicles.

    3. Light Massage: Gently massage the shampoo into your scalp using your fingertips. Avoid using your nails or applying too much pressure, as this can disturb the healing process.

    4. Pat Dry: After washing, gently pat your hair dry with a soft towel. Avoid rubbing or scrubbing, as this can cause unnecessary friction and stress to the scalp.

    Ongoing Care and Monitoring

    Following the initial 48-hour period, continue to monitor your scalp for any signs of infection or complications. If you notice any redness, swelling, or unusual discharge, contact your doctor immediately. Regular follow-up appointments are also essential to ensure that your scalp is healing correctly and that the transplanted hair is growing as expected.

    In conclusion, adhering to the 48-hour waiting period and using gentle washing techniques are vital steps in the post-hair transplant care process. By following these guidelines, you can help ensure a smooth recovery and the best possible outcome for your hair transplant in Halifax.
